I've created a patch implementing this in <https://reviews.llvm.org/D43333>. Let me know what you think of it (particularly of the parts that will become the "stable API").
On 14 February 2018 at 18:43, Greg Clayton <[email protected]> wrote: > I second Jim's idea for a static function on SBDebugger that returns a > SBStructuredData > >> On Feb 14, 2018, at 10:31 AM, Jim Ingham via lldb-dev >> <[email protected]> wrote: >> >> The idea of having a static function in SBDebugger that returns lldb >> configuration information seems good to me. >> >> Having the API return an SBStructuredData with the full configuration >> information seems like a pretty future-proof way to do this. I can't see >> that this data will get sufficiently large that consing up the whole set of >> config options to answer a single question is going to be a problem, and the >> info is constant for the run of lldb, so you can cache the result. >> >> Jim >> >> >>> On Feb 5, 2018, at 4:01 AM, Pavel Labath via lldb-dev >>> <[email protected]> wrote: >>> >>> Hello all, >>> >>> In <https://reviews.llvm.org/D42145> we have a feature that only works >>> when lldb was built with xml support. To test this, we need the test >>> to know whether we were build with xml support. >>> >>> The typical llvm solution would be to generate some dotest equivalent >>> of lit.site.cfg at build time, which we could then load from the test >>> and query for build settings. >>> >>> However, it has occurred to me that the information about various >>> build properties (xml suport, libedit support, list of llvm targets we >>> support) is something that could be useful to other liblldb clients as >>> well. So, another way of exposing this would be to have a function >>> (maybe a static function on SBDebugger ?) that the test can call and >>> get the required information that way. >>> >>> Do you have any thoughts on how this should be handled?
